What is the name of Breidavik's airport?
Book a flight to Breidavik with Expedia and you'll be landing at Bildudalur Airport (BIU).
How far is BIU from central Breidavik?
Bíldudalur Airport is 40 kilometres from downtown Breidavik, so prepare yourself for a bit of a journey into the centre of the city.

Which airlines fly to Breidavik?
The majority of flights to Breidavik are operated by Norlandair. The most well-known route departs from Reykjavik, and Norlandair flies this route the most.
How many nonstop flights are there to Breidavik?
Organising an amazing Breidavik holiday is child's play when there are 8 nonstop flights every week to choose from.

How long is the flight to Breidavik Airport?
You can expect a flight duration of about 35 minutes from Reykjavik to Breidavik.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Make sure you don't have a sharp object hiding in one of the zippers of your hand luggage. Other banned items include flammable or explosive substances, such as aerosol cans and bleach, and gels and liquids in containers with a capacity of more than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res).

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should be your number one priority when choosing what to wear during your flight. Loose, breathable clothing is a smart option, as are enclosed shoes like sneakers.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a potential risk on long-haul flights. It's the result of blood clots forming due to poor circulation, so do some gentle foot and leg ex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ks or tights.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Breidavik?
Being organised before you arrive at the airport will help make your getaway to Breidavik quick and painless. We've compiled some top tips for a speedy journey through security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to make sure that you have a valid passport and matching boarding pass before anything else. Have them ready for inspection.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your belt, coat, keys and other small items, like your earphones,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them before your turn arrives.
  • All your electronic devices, including your phone and laptop, must also be scanned separately.
  • Can't travel without your favourite perfume? As long as the volume is no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and it's stored in a zip-lock bag, it's OK to bring with you in your carry-on bag.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you several minutes. Hiking or heavy-style boots are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Lightweight sneakers usually aren't.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, put them in your checked baggage. They won't be allowed on board.
